Values are principles and standards of behavior that govern the society; however, a trend is developing where decadence in values is being excused for fame especially for Society influencers like artists and people that are held in high esteem.
Today, personalities, especially those in media (both mainstream and social) have become the custodians of values and whatever they do or say goes. It is, therefore, vital that they use their influence with utmost sensitivity to what they portray so that the moral fabric is protected. It saddens that these platforms especially social media are being used to spread the message that nakedness, alcoholism, drug abuse, materiality, and fashion (normally called Luku) are what determine whether or not one is acceptable in the eyes of society.
Starting from TV shows to Vulgar music, it is quite clear that the entertainment trends have changed but this should not mean that a misdirection from the core values is acceptable. Just because it is being done doesn’t make it right. The older generation in their thirties and forties should now be at the forefront in developing mentorship hubs to give direction to teenagers and the younger generation.
It’s time we went back to the basics, what makes us unique as a people. The ethics, values, standards, principles, and the essence for which we are different from any other society in Africa and Globally. We cannot afford to deviate from our core, from consciousness, that which drives our decisions and makes us see the bigger picture
